      <title>Indy soph Collin Hartman Drawing Attention</title>
      <description>The state of Indiana is producing an abundance of top basketball prospects for the 2013 class.  Simply stated, that class is loaded.  One who has risen rapidly is Indianapolis sophomore Collin Hartman.  His AAU team's tallest member, he must play inside part of the time.  But he will ultimately be a wing player.</description>
